On October 21, India commemorates Police Commemoration Day. It is a national holiday to honor the martyrs who gave their lives in the course of service. It is also a day to thank the officers and families of those who continue to serve and protect us on a daily basis.

📜 History of Police Commemoration Day

According to official sources at the time, three reconnaissance groups were launched the day before from Ladakh as part of an Indian expedition to Lanak La. Only two of these parties, however, returned. The following morning, D.C.I.O Shri Karam Singh led a search party of 20 officers from the Intelligence Bureau and the C.R.P.F. to look for the missing group. They rode their horses, while the rest of the crew followed on foot. The Chinese forces started fire and tossed grenades at Singh’s party, which was unprotected, about noon. The attack resulted in the deaths of ten men, the capture of seven, and injuries to the other seven, who escaped.

After three weeks, the Chinese finally turned over the martyrs’ corpses to the country. They were then cremated with full police honors in Ladakh’s hot springs. Along with the tremendous wrath that swept the country, there was an outpouring of respect for the valiant warriors who had battled till the bitter end. In January 1960, the annual Conference of Inspectors General of Police of States and Union Territories decided October 21 to be “Commemoration Day.”

☑️ Police Commemoration Day facts

A skewed ratio
For every 100,000 inhabitants, there are just 130 officers.

The job can take a hefty toll
According to a National Crime Records Bureau survey, Mumbai has the highest incidence of police suicides in India.

Friends through football
Children in Delhi play football with police as part of an effort by a non-government group to make children less afraid of the police.
